Transaction b762f2bedd01388c85e04382a3b8f2f10c3c201759f7b0f7618d2e14d1a964bd

block
8156b45367ea17588b604b2fead81ee63b69f45b595775123773d79e71f7d11a

1 Input

50 Outputs